Product Introduction

Overview

The VB525SP-E is a high voltage power integrated circuit designed by STMicroelectronics using their VIPower™ M1-3 technology. This device is specifically tailored for advanced electronic ignition systems, offering a robust and intelligent interface between the control logic and the high energy ignition coil. It features a Darlington and logic level compatible vertical current flow power driving circuit, making it suitable for high voltage and high current applications.

Key Specifications

Parameter Value Unit
Collector Voltage (internally limited) -0.3 to Vclamp V
Collector Current (internally limited) 10 A
DC Current on Emitter Power ±10.5 A
Driving Stage Supply Voltage -0.3 to 7 V
High Voltage Clamp 320 to 420 V
Low Voltage Clamp 30 to 50 V
Power Stage Saturation Voltage 1.5 to 2 V
Standby Supply Current 11 mA
Operating Junction Temperature -40 to 150 °C
Storage Temperature Range -55 to 150 °C
Thermal Resistance Junction-Case 1 °C/W
Thermal Resistance Junction-Ambient 51 °C/W

Key Features

  • Primary coil voltage internally set
  • Coil current limit internally set
  • Logic level compatible input
  • Driving current quasi proportional to collector current
  • Single flag on coil current for diagnostic purposes
  • Low voltage clamp thermal shutdown for overheating protection
  • ECOPACK®: lead free and RoHS compliant
  • Built-in protection circuit for coil current limiting and collector voltage clamping

Applications

The VB525SP-E is primarily designed for use in advanced electronic ignition systems. It interfaces directly with high energy electronic ignition coils and is driven by a logic level input from an external controller. This device is suitable for various automotive and industrial applications where high voltage and high current switching are required.

Q & A

  1. What is the primary function of the VB525SP-E?

    The VB525SP-E is a high voltage power integrated circuit designed to drive high energy electronic ignition coils in advanced ignition systems.

  2. What technology is used in the VB525SP-E?

    The VB525SP-E is made using STMicroelectronics' VIPower™ M1-3 technology.

  3. What are the key protection features of the VB525SP-E?

    The device includes coil current limiting, collector voltage clamping, and low voltage clamp thermal shutdown to protect against overheating and overvoltage conditions.

  4. What is the maximum collector voltage and current for the VB525SP-E?

    The maximum collector voltage is internally limited up to Vclamp, and the maximum collector current is 10 A.

  5. How does the VB525SP-E handle thermal issues?

    The device features thermal shutdown intervention at 150°C and has specified thermal resistances to manage heat dissipation.

  6. Is the VB525SP-E environmentally friendly?

    Yes, the VB525SP-E is ECOPACK® compliant, meaning it is lead free and RoHS compliant.

  7. What is the operating temperature range for the VB525SP-E?

    The operating junction temperature range is -40 to 150°C, and the storage temperature range is -55 to 150°C.

  8. How does the enable pin function in the VB525SP-E?

    The enable pin allows the switch to be externally blocked when the input is on. It can be grounded to enable the input or left floating to keep the output off.

  9. What are the typical applications of the VB525SP-E?

    The VB525SP-E is used in advanced electronic ignition systems, particularly in automotive and industrial applications requiring high voltage and high current switching.

  10. How does the VB525SP-E handle overvoltage transients?

    The device can withstand various overvoltage transients on the battery line, including -100 V / 2 msec, +100 V / 0.2 msec, and +50 V / 400 msec under specified conditions.
